A Graduate Certificate in Quantum Computing specializing in Quantum Theory provides focused training in the foundational principles governing quantum mechanics and its applications in computation. The program equips students with a deep understanding of quantum phenomena, essential for advancements in this rapidly evolving field.
Learning outcomes typically include mastering the mathematical formalism of quantum mechanics, including linear algebra and Hilbert spaces. Students will develop expertise in quantum gates, quantum algorithms, and quantum information theory. They will also gain practical experience through simulations and potentially hands-on laboratory work, depending on the program's structure. This rigorous curriculum is designed to build a strong base in quantum theory and its computational aspects.
The duration of a Graduate Certificate in Quantum Computing varies, typically ranging from a few months to a year of part-time or full-time study. The program's intensity and credit requirements dictate the overall timeframe. Many programs offer flexible scheduling to accommodate working professionals seeking to enhance their skillsets.
